"abdominoscrotal muscle" meaning in English

See abdominoscrotal muscle in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

IPA: /æbˌdɑm.ɪ.noʊ.skɹoʊ.tl̩ ˈmʌs.l̩/ [US] Forms: abdominoscrotal muscles [plural]
Etymology: From Latin abdomen (“abdomen”) + New Latin scrotalis, from Latin scrotum; abdomino- + -scrotal. Etymology templates: {{der|en|la|abdomen||abdomen}} Latin abdomen (“abdomen”), {{der|en|NL.|-}} New Latin, {{der|en|la|scrotum}} Latin scrotum, {{confix|en|abdomino|scrotal}} abdomino- + -scrotal Head templates: {{en-noun}} abdominoscrotal muscle (plural abdominoscrotal muscles)
  1. (anatomy) the cremaster muscle. Categories (topical): Anatomy
